Do Grass Ticks Carry Lyme Disease . Not all ticks carry the lyme disease bacteria. Depending on the location, anywhere from less than 1% to more than 50% of the ticks are infected with it. Adult deer ticks actually are more likely to carry the bacterium, borrelia burgdorferi, that causes lyme disease, dapsis says. While most tick bites are harmless, several species can. Only two species of tick transmit lyme disease, both from the genus ixodes. In the east and upper midwest regions of the united states, the primary tick species is ixodes scapularis (or deer tick).
